Definition

To match with, accord with, or make sense.

neutraldescriptionscommunication

How it's used

Used primarily in formal or semi-formal contexts to describe logical consistency or alignment between two things. It rarely stands alone as a verb in everyday speech, appearing most frequently as part of compound words like 符合 or 吻合. When used as a standalone verb, it often carries a slightly literary or analytical tone compared to more common colloquial verbs like 對得上.

Common mistake

Avoid using it in casual conversation as a direct replacement for match in the sense of physical items, such as clothes or colors, where 襯 is the appropriate choice.
